All students of jiu-jitsu benefit from this step-by-step textbook, which takes them from the white belt right up to the ultimate, coveted goal of black belt. The comprehensive method assembled here by the well-regarded Gracie family lets fighters know exactly what they need to learn, when and why they need to learn it, and what they can do to progress more quickly. How and how often to train, pacing, training objectives, and how to measure success are all addressed according to the different goals students might have, from the casual practitioner to the self-defense student to the competitor bent on going pro. The plan detailed in the text can be customized to fit the trainee's body type and strengths. Instructors of jiu-jitsu will also find the manual helpful to their teaching, as it provides advice on program management, student evaluation, the selection of techniques for lessons, and recognizing a prodigy.

As two young students begin their journey to become Black Belts, invaders arrive and forbid the practice of all martial arts! From the distant past comes a story about an old master, and the indomitable spirit he shares with two young students. This comic book shares the story of two students on their journey to become a Black Belt and the lessons they learn on that path. In addition to the story, the book includes bonus materials: a Taekwondo vocabulary sheet, and a list of the Taekwondo belts, forms and their symbolism.The word Taekwondo comes from three words which mean to kick with the foot, to punch with the fist, and follow a way of discipline. When you learn Taekwondo you go through a series of belts, starting with white, advancing through the color belts of yellow, green, blue, red on your way to becoming a Black Belt.With each belt you will learn a new form or poomse. Each poomse is a physical vocabulary of stances, blocks, kicks and punches used in Taekwondo. Each poomse has a name such as "Taeguk O Jang" and a symbol such as Air or Water. These symbols share with us key elements of life and character that we should always be mindful of.As you progress through the belts you learn increasingly challenging physical skills, and valuable life skills that apply to all areas of your life. The discipline of Taekwondo will greatly enhance not only your health but also your character and your ability to be successful in life.
